imbian 发表于 2013-8-24 00:26:25

度娘竟然可以获取在google搜索过的关键字?

在google搜索了下关于“函授”的资料,过了几个小时之后,在一个完全不相干的网站上竟然发现百度联盟显示的是关于“函授”的广告,这是什么原理?


蜘蛛 发表于 2013-8-24 00:40:56

是读取额cookie吗?

微笑君 发表于 2013-8-24 00:42:35

楼主有没有装什么插件读取了cookies

echo 发表于 2013-8-24 01:15:55

我也是这样的

flow 发表于 2013-8-24 02:35:04

是不是同时使用了百度搜索?

augustye 发表于 2013-8-24 06:30:22

我也遇到过这个情况,百度肯定读不到google搜索的cookie, 但是搜索后访问的网站可能有百度的广告链接,从而让百度拿到cookie,来路以及页面关键词等信息。

yoo 发表于 2013-8-24 07:13:44

百度读取Google的Cookies,完全没有这种可能性,就算是进入另外一个挂了百度广告的网站,也完全不可能得到Google的Cookies。
出现这种情况的原因,是百度自己写下了Cookies。当你通过Google搜索结果,进入某个网站时,由于这个网站挂了百度的广告,百度这时就在你电脑中写下Cookies。这个网站的内容是与函授有关,百度就写下了有关函授内容的Cookies。当你访问其他含有百度广告的网站时,百度读取自己的Cookies,然后显示函授相关内容的广告。

bjzhush 发表于 2013-8-24 08:21:08

楼上的分析很靠谱,浏览器是有同源策略的
虽然可能有各种各样的小手段来捣鬼,但是某些策略就像物理法则一样存在(有漏洞被利用的情况例外)
从技术上说,js是完全可以获取到referer的
从实际情况分析,百度AD等广泛分布在互联网中,如果你从google搜索keyword到A站,A站挂了百度AD/其它xxx的广告 ,百度AD的js读取了referer ,可能有两种做法
1.结合当前浏览器的UUID发送给百度Server,记录下用户的搜索历史,从而实现个性化推荐广告
2.不记录,只是单纯带上监测到的搜索关键词,作为参数传给本次广告,影响到本次广告展示

第一种做法肯定更优,但是也更费精力,不过以百度的能力,做第一种完全不成问题

bluescharp 发表于 2013-8-24 13:17:11

你用了baidu的工具栏了么?

maketuwen 发表于 2013-8-24 14:22:09

cookie随便读的

whynotuww 发表于 2013-8-24 14:34:57

淘宝的广告也能识别你最近搜了哪些关键词,不论你是在度娘、谷姐、360还是搜狗。。。。

河小马 发表于 2013-8-24 23:47:05

re-targeting

因为这些数据是可以出售的

有个exchange
页: [1]
查看完整版本: 度娘竟然可以获取在google搜索过的关键字?